    I can appreciate that there are people who would really like to have full loot on death in PVP. Who doesn't like loot?
    I can also see the problems that come with this in story progression, people not using their best gear, and encouraging PVEers into PVP.
    So, I'd like to suggest a compromise.

    Full loot, HOWEVER, there exists an instanced replacement store where a player can purchase an identical replacement (including wear and tear) of any item that he or she has ever owned that has subsequently been looted.
    This replacement cannot be sold, and should cost at least as much as the average market rate for this type of item. This is to prevent intentional gear duplication exploits, and depression of market values due to oversupply.
    This would allow people to recover lost equipment so that they could continue in a given story line, etc., while adding the thrill of full loot as a reward for skill in combat.

    If and only if a really great item did get acquired, yes I know the devs have said items will not have uber stats, then there is still an easy two man exploit.

    Top of the line items always experience price escalation on the open market, because there are surprising numbers of players willing to bust the bank to own one.

    Get one such item, have your buddy looot you, he sells it, you buy another from the store. He gives you the price of the replacement plus half the profits.

    Rinse repeat till the open market price approaches the item repurchase price.

    At this point both players are filthy rich, and the community is flooded by slightly dinged up copies of the latest and greatest weapon. Depreciation, market flooding, and devaluation of multiple market pathways occurs.
